Abstract

The quality of steering systems and their application has significant impact on the overall assessment of handling performance. In some cases it is even possible to mask non-optimum handling characteristics with a good steering system. On the other hand a nice and smooth vehicle may be ruined by a bad steering application. The impact of steering systems and their application has increased with the introduction of vehiclespeed dependent assist forces. The biggest boost in challenges appeared with the introduction of Electric Power Steering (EPS) systems and their application process still offers a couple of challenges.
